Key Factors to Consider Before Buying Property in Belize
Before purchasing real estate in Belize, it is important to understand the key factors that influence a successful investment. One of the most important considerations is location. Coastal areas such as Ambergris Caye offer strong rental demand but come with higher prices, while inland areas provide more affordable land with long-term appreciation potential. Choosing the right location depends on your goals, whether personal living, retirement, or investment.
Another critical factor is property title verification. Buyers should always ensure that the land has a clear and transferable title. Working with experienced professionals like Belize Realty can help ensure proper due diligence is conducted. This includes checking ownership history, surveying boundaries, and confirming there are no legal disputes attached to the property.
Infrastructure is also an important consideration. Some remote areas may lack developed roads, electricity, or water systems, which can affect construction costs. On the other hand, developed communities offer convenience but may come at a premium price. Understanding these trade-offs helps buyers make informed decisions that align with their budget and expectations.
Financing is another aspect to keep in mind. While cash purchases are common in Belize, some local financing options exist, though they may be limited compared to larger countries. Many international buyers prefer to fund purchases through savings or foreign lending institutions. Currency exchange rates and transaction fees should also be considered when planning your investment.
Lastly, understanding local regulations and taxes is essential. Property taxes in Belize are generally low, but it is still important to be aware of annual obligations and any potential development restrictions. Consulting local experts ensures compliance and helps avoid unexpected challenges.

Step-by-Step Process to Secure Your Ideal Property in Belize
Buying property in Belize follows a structured process that is relatively straightforward compared to many other countries. The first step is identifying your goals. Whether you want a vacation home, rental investment, or retirement property, defining your purpose helps narrow down the best locations and property types.
Next, buyers typically begin searching through listings and working with agencies like Belize Realty. This stage involves property visits, either physically or virtually, depending on your location. During this phase, it is important to evaluate the surroundings, access to utilities, and potential for future growth.
Once a suitable property is found, the negotiation process begins. Offers are made based on market value, and both parties agree on terms. At this stage, a deposit is usually required to secure the property while legal checks are completed. This ensures the property is taken off the market during due diligence.
The legal phase includes title verification, contract preparation, and final approval. Attorneys play a major role in ensuring that the transaction is legitimate and that the buyer receives full ownership rights. This step is essential for protecting your investment and avoiding future disputes.
Finally, the closing process takes place. Once all documents are signed and payments are completed, ownership is officially transferred. Buyers then receive the title deed, confirming their legal ownership of the property. From here, they can begin development, renting, or enjoying their new home in Belize.
